Code of conduct for the Atelier UI project
We are committed to making Atelier UI a welcoming, inclusive, and harassment-free community for everyone, regardless of age, body size, disability, ethnicity, gender identity and expression, level of experience, nationality, personal appearance, race, religion, or sexual identity and orientation.
If you experience or witness unacceptable behavior, please report it by opening an issue on our GitHub repository. When reporting, include a clear description of the incident, the people involved, and any supporting evidence such as screenshots or links.
All reports will be reviewed promptly and handled confidentially.

Maintainers have the right to remove, edit, or reject comments, commits, issues, and other contributions that do not align with this Code of Conduct.
This Code of Conduct applies to all project spaces, including GitHub repositories, issues, pull requests, discussions, and any public space where someone is representing Atelier UI. It also applies when interacting with the community on social media or at events.
This Code of Conduct is adapted from the Contributor Covenant, version 2.1.
